## Onboarding: Farebranch Rules Engine

Plugin authors integrate with Farebranch by registering fee rules against the evaluation API. Rules are sandboxed; they cannot perform network calls directly. All rate-table lookups go through the host, which validates your plugin manifest at load time. Your local env file must include the signing credential the host uses to verify manifests, set on the next line.

secret setting of bajef-fajof: COURIER_KEY3=76c

Ticket: Config drift between staging and prod on Marrowbend's migration runner. Staging applies schema migrations with the expand/contract flow; prod still uses the legacy lock-and-swap path, risking downtime. Reviewer: confirm the zero-downtime settings below match staging before merge. Dual-write window and backfill batch size were tuned last sprint. The intended production values are as follows.

service settings:
WENATH_PIN=5007
WENATH_METRICS_HOST=metrics.wenath.tolvaqlabs.corp
WENATH_LOG_LEVEL=debug
WENATH_TENANT=rusox

**Management Meeting Minutes — Logistics Transition**

Attendees: R. Hallveck, M. Osiander, T. Brell. The committee reviewed the proposed switch from Quarrow Freight to Velmont Carriage for all outbound distribution from the Dunmarsh depot. Velmont's tender shows a 7% saving on lane costs and improved cold-chain tracking. Contract exit fees with Quarrow were confirmed as manageable. Finance should note the commercial context summarised below.

internal memo for kawip-hadug: Headcount on the Wenwyn team goes from 7 to 140 by the end of January. Gross margin on Wenwyn came in at 20 percent against a plan of 15 percent.

## Environments — Shelfhound catalog cache

Shelfhound runs three environments: dev, staging, prod. Cache invalidation for the product catalog is event-driven in prod, timer-based elsewhere. Staging mirrors prod topology but with a single invalidation worker, so expect stale reads up to two minutes. Never test purge storms against prod. Dev is wiped nightly. Each environment overrides the base config; the staging values you'll touch most often are these.

settings of hagug-yawip:
druix:
  pin: 0136
  metrics_host: metrics.druix.qorvellabs.internal
  tenant: kelox
  seal: seal_71ff4acd